About Matthew Stephen Goeing

Matthew Stephen Goeing is a lawyer practicing civil litigation, personal injury, tax liens and 5 other areas of law. Matthew received a B.S. degree from University of Kentucky in 2005, and has been licensed for 18 years. Matthew practices at Goeing Law PLLC in Lexington, KY.
